BREEZE-M R/B, 36102 is space debris in HEO originally from a launch on Tue, 24 Nov 2009 UTC launched from the Tyuratam Missile And Space Complex (TTMTR). Debris objects in space refer to the collection of defunct objects orbiting the Earth. Examples of debris include non-operational satellites, rocket bodies, and fragments generated from explosions, collisions, or faulty payload assembly.
